Frequently Asked Questions

  • What is WCC Grading?
    WCC Grading is a professional card grading company that evaluates the condition and authenticity of trading cards, encapsulating them in tamper-proof slabs for long-term protection. We focus on accuracy, transparency, and consistency in grading.
  • What types of cards do you grade?
    We grade a wide variety of cards, including sports, trading card games (TCG), and non-sports cards. Please refer to our "Accepted Cards" section for a full list of what we grade.
  • Do you grade autographs?
    We only grade autographs that are guaranteed by the card's original manufacturer. We do not authenticate or grade hand-signed autographs that have not been certified by the manufacturer.

  • Do you alter cards before grading?
    No, we do not alter cards in any way. However, we do offer a cleaning service, which consists of a basic wipe-down to remove dust and debris before grading. This service ensures your card is free from minor surface contaminants before encapsulation.
  • How does WCC Grading determine a card's grade?
    We use a detailed grading scale that evaluates centering, corners, edges, and surface condition. Cards are graded on a scale from 1 to 10, with 10 being pristine.
  • Do you provide subgrades?
    Yes, we offer subgrades that provide a breakdown of centering, corners, edges, and surface condition for a more detailed assessment of your card.
  • Are your slabs tamper-proof?
    Yes, our slabs are designed to be secure and tamper-proof, ensuring the protection of your graded cards. They are made from high-quality, durable materials with excellent clarity for display purposes.
  • Do you offer crossover grading?
    Yes, we offer crossover grading. If your card is already graded by another company and you wish to have it graded by us, we can evaluate it in its existing case before deciding whether to reholder it in a WCC slab.

  • Do you offer refunds if I'm unhappy with my grade?
    No, all grading decisions are final. Our grading process is designed to be as objective as possible, using detailed assessment criteria.
  • How should I package my cards for submission?
    Cards should be placed in penny sleeves and semi-rigid cardholders, then securely packaged in a box with proper padding to prevent movement during transit.
